SNAP Distribution Schedule for Indiana

In Indiana, the Family and Social Services Administration administers SNAP benefits. In February 2025, these benefits will be loaded onto beneficiaries’ Electronic Benefit Transfer (EBT) cards from February 5 to February 23. The distribution schedule is as follows:

  • Benefits will be distributed based on the first letter of the beneficiaries’ last name.
First Letter of Last NameBenefit Availability Date
A or BFebruary 5
C or DFebruary 7
E, F, or GFebruary 9
H or IFebruary 11
J, K, or LFebruary 13
M or NFebruary 15
O, P, Q, or RFebruary 17
SFebruary 19
T, U, or VFebruary 21
W, X, Y, or ZFebruary 23

Georgia SNAP Distribution Schedule

In Georgia, the Division of Family and Children Services administers SNAP benefits. For February 2025, benefit distributions in the state of Georgia will be made from February 5 to February 23, and will be determined based on the last two digits of the beneficiaries’ Identification Number (ID).

ID Number Ending InBenefit Availability Date
00-09February 5
10-19February 7
20-29February 9
30-39February 11
40-49February 13
50-59February 15
60-69February 17
70-79February 19
80-89February 21
90-99February 23

Maximum SNAP Benefit Amount

The maximum SNAP amount is determined by family size and is updated each year. In FY 2025, the maximum monthly assistance amount is determined by family size.

Household SizeMaximum Monthly Benefit
1$292
2$536
3$768
4$975
5$1,158
6$1,384
7$1,536
8$1,756
Each additional member+$220
